A method for remotely controlling power consumption of at least one server, comprising:
providing remote control to an administrator over a power state of at least one server;
building an instruction command and encoding it into a suitable format for transport over a data network from an administration terminal to the at least one server; and
interpreting the command and executing the command by the at least one server without powering down the at least one server.

Abstract
A power management device with a remote control function configured in a computer system includes a power management unit, a remote control receiver, and a remote control transmitter. The power management unit is configured in the computer system for managing the power of the computer system. The remote control receiver is electrically connected to the power management unit. The remote control transmitter is used for transmitting a control signal. The control signal is received and processed by the remote control receiver to control the power management unit.

An energy management system for monitoring and analyzing the power consumption at a plurality of locations. The energy management system includes a primary server connected to at least one building server or other device through a computer network. Each of the building servers are connected to one or more energy meters contained in a building.
